meistre pycelle é uma ferramenta de código aberto, amplamente utilizada em ambientes corporativos e acadêmicos, que permite a criação, manipulação e análise visual de workflows de dados, integrando de forma declarativa diversas tecnologias de banco de dados e linguagens de programação.

Dentre suas características mais notáveis destacam-se uma interface baseada em fluxo (flow-based), suporte nativo a SQL, Python e R, capacidades de versionamento de pipelines, auditoria granular de execução e extensibilidade por meio de plugins. Em termos de funcionamento, o meistre pycelle transforma as conexões entre blocos de lógica em um grafo acíclico, onde cada nó representa uma transformação ou consulta, sendo executado de forma otimizada e rastreável.

Exemplos práticos incluem a construção de pipelines de ETL para data warehouses, a preparação de bases para modelos de machine learning e a automação de relatórios gerenciais com atualização programada. Este artigo explora em profundidade o meistre pycelle, abordando desde a arquitetura até casos de uso avançados.

Pycelle | Wiki Game of Thrones | FANDOM powered by Wikia
Pycelle | Wiki Game of Thrones | FANDOM powered by Wikia

O que é o meistre pycelle e para que serve?

O meistre pycelle nasce como uma resposta à crescente demanda por ferramentas que unam agilidade no desenvolvimento de data pipelines com robustez operacional. Diferente de soluções que impõem uma linguagem única, o meistre pycelle prioriza a interoperabilidade, permitindo que engenheiros de dados escolham a tecnologia mais adequada para cada etapa do fluxo.

Seu propósito principal é reduzir a fricção entre a fase de exploração analítica e a de produção, oferecendo um ambiente visual que facilita o entendimento do fluxo por stakeholders técnicos e não técnicos.

Quais são os principais recursos e características do meistre pycelle?

  • Fluxograma intuitivo: construção de pipelines através de arrastar e soltar, com nós representando transformações, consultas ou scripts personalizados.
  • Linguagens multi-paradigma: integração direta com SQL para consultas otimizadas, Python para lógica complexa e R para estatística avançada.
  • Versionamento e controle de mudanças: rastreamento de alterações nos pipelines, ramificação e merge, similar ao Git, mas focado em artefatos de dados.
  • Auditoria e logs detalhados: captura de metadados em cada execução, incluindo parâmetros, perfis de dados e indicadores de qualidade.
  • Extensibilidade via plugins: possibilidade de adicionar novos conectores, sensores de qualidade ou bibliotecas específicas de terceiros.

Como o meistre pycelle funciona por trás dos panos?

Arquitetura baseada em grafos de tarefas

O núcleo do meistre pycelle modela cada pipeline como um grafo dirigido, onde vértices são unidades de processamento e arestas representam fluxos de dados. Essa representação permite a paralelização inteligente e a detecção de gargalos em tempo de execução.

Game Of Thrones Grand Maester Pycelle
Game Of Thrones Grand Maester Pycelle

Motor de otimização e execução

Antes de disparar as tarefas, o mecanismo interno analisa o grafo, reordenando operações para minimizar shuffles de dados e aproveitando índices existentes. Durante a execução, cada nó é encapsulado em um container leve, isolando dependências e garantindo reprodutibilidade.

Quais são os principais casos de uso do meistre pycelle?

Engenharia de dados e ETL moderno

Empresas utilizam o meistre pycelle para orquestrar cargas diárias, aplicando regras de negócio complexas antes de materializar tabelas no data warehouse.

Ciência de dados e machine learning

Cientistas de dados constroem experimentos que combinam pré-processamento em Python, feature engineering em SQL e validação estatística em R, tudo dentro de um único fluxo rastreável.

Grand Maester Pycelle | Game of thrones, As cronicas, Série de televisão
Grand Maester Pycelle | Game of thrones, As cronicas, Série de televisão

Relatórios automatizados e compliance

Operações de extração, transformação e entrega de relatórios seguem pipelines definidos no meistre pycelle, garantindo que cada etapa seja auditada e replicável.

Quais são as vantagens de adotar o meistre pycelle em projetos de dados?

  • Produtividade visual: equipes conseguem prototipar pipelines em horas, não em semanas, reduzindo o tempo de validação de hipóteses.
  • Menos retrabalho: ao versionar fluxos, evita-se a recriação manual de pipelines quando requisitos mudam.
  • Transparência para stakeholders: o fluxograma serve como documentação viva, facilitando a comunicação entre áreas.
  • Escalabilidade: o arquitetura modular permite escalar horizontalmente ao adicionar novos nós ou clusters de processamento.

Como começar a usar o meistre pycelle no dia a dia?

A curva de aprendizado do meistre pycelle é relativamente suave, especialmente para quem já trabalha com SQL ou Python. Recomenda-se iniciar criando um fluxo simples de extração, transformação e carga (ETL), utilizando os conectores nativos e, aos poucos, integrar scripts personalizados.

Documentação extensa, tutoriais passo a passo e uma comunidade ativa garantem suporte contínuo, enquanto recursos como preview de dados e testes unitários para cada nó ajudam a manter a qualidade ao longo do tempo.

Jogo Dos Tronos Grande Meistre Pycelle Crítica – Game Of Thrones
Jogo Dos Tronos Grande Meistre Pycelle Crítica – Game Of Thrones

Perguntas frequentes

O meistre pycelle é adequado para empresas de pequeno porte?

Sim, pois sua arquitetura modular permite desde implantações leves em ambientes desktop até integrações em grandes data centers, conforme a necessidade de escala.

É possível integrar o meistre pycelle com ferramentas de BI tradicionais?

Com certeza, uma vez que os pipelines gerados podem ser expostos como views, APIs ou arquivos otimizados, alinhando-se perfeitamente com plataformas de business intelligence.

Como o meistre pycelle garante segurança nos dados durante a execução?

O platforma oferece criptografia em trânsito e em repouso, além de controles de acesso baseados em funções, garantindo que apenas usuários autorizados modifiquem ou executem pipelines sensíveis.

Pycelle Grand Maester Game of thrones by Blixtnatt RIP | Costumes de ...
Pycelle Grand Maester Game of thrones by Blixtnatt RIP | Costumes de ...

Existem limitações significativas no uso de scripts personalizados?

Embora o meistre pycelle seja altamente flexível, é recomendável seguir boas práticas de engenharia de software, como modularização e tratamento de exceções, para garantir manutenibilidade a longo prazo.